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9296835 23791030 11110 9042
10792650 1830548
10792650 1830548
90874682 00300686 56
All about undefined
Interested in learning more?
10792650 1830548
90874682 00300686 56
See more
4400 05625202 9898
74 059 7021212079 8139005 36454725481
See more
390001257 2414350027 3182887
435655536 156163037 73
See more